nivelpussi
Nivelpussi, in Finnish medical terminology, refers to the synovial bursa, a small fluid-filled sac near a joint. Bursae are lined by a synovial membrane and contain slippery synovial fluid. They function to cushion moving tissues such as tendons and bones and to reduce friction during joint movement.
Structure and distribution: Bursae can be superficial under the skin or deep next to the joint capsule
